Preoperative Window Opportunity Study With Giredestrant or Tamoxifen in Premenopausal Women With ER+/HER2[-] & Ki67≥10%

NCT05659563

Phase 2 Completed 92 enrolled MedSIR
RandomizedParallel-groupOpen-labelTreatment

Summary

This study is a window of opportunity clinical trial to evaluate the efficacy of giredestrant (GDC-9545) or tamoxifen in estrogen receptor-positive (ER\[+\])/human epidermal growth factor receptor 2-negative (HER2\[-\]) primary invasive adenocarcinoma of the breast with Ki67 level ≥ 10%. A total of 92 patients will be enrolled in this trial and randomized 1:1 in the arm A with giredestrant (GDC-9545) and the arm B with tamoxifen, with a total duration of treatment of 15 days. This study will analyze the efficacy of giredestrant (GDC-9545) as determined by Ki67 expression between baseline tumor biopsy samples and post-treatment biopsy samples.
